CIAL SYSTEM 2500 5000 FRESHWATER USER GUIDE C Maintenance Instructions Recommended regular maintenance tasks for the SYSTEM 2500 5000 DAILY MAINTENANCE e Check overall system and livestock health for early signs of problems e Check bag filters for blockages and wash as necessary Check rotation of bio tower spray bar e Check sand bed fluidisation level and adjust accordingly WEEKLY MAINTENANCE Carry out regular water tests with particular reference to pH ammonia and nitrite when the system is maturing e Perform partial water change generally around 10 e Check water salinity density e Change bag filters If new bags are used rinse in freshwater before installation Carry out a visual check on pump strainer baskets and intake strainers MONTHLY MAINTENANCE Inspect pump UV steriliser and filter seals e Due to the abrasive nature of the fluidised sand bed filter media the bowl may need to be replaced periodically and should be inspected for any signs of wear Replacement bowls are available from TMC product code FSB VFCA4G8 BIANNUAL MAINTENANCE e Change ultra violet lamps using TMC 55 Watt UV lamps product code 6056 e Clean quartz sleeves product code 5277 on UV steriliser and replace o rings product code 5281 Inspect bio media for mulm build up and clean replace as necessary Check and clean clear pump lids The system has been designed with as much flexibility as VERSION 2

SAFETY INFORMATION All units must be mounted with the lamps in a horizontal position Never mount the unit with the lamps in a vertical position Incorrect mounting and positioning will result in malfunction and permanent damage to the unit e Never look directly at an illuminated UV lamp e Do not operate the unit when disconnected from the water supply or allow the unit to run dry Always isolate the unit from mains electricity and turn off the water supply prior to carrying out maintenance Always disconnect from mains supply before putting your hands into the water e Electricity should be supplied through a Residual Current Device RCD with a rated residual operating current not exceeding 30mA e The unit must be earthed Do not use a fuse larger than 3 amps e Rating UK and European models 220 240 v 50 Hz Class 1 IP64 e Rating USA models 120 v 60 Hz Class 1 IP64 e The unit must not be submerged in water VERSION 22 03 2013 PAGE 14 TMC COMMERCIAL SYSTEM 2500 5000 FRESHWATER USER GUIDE e The unit must be fully frost protected or taken inside during the winter months e Do not install it above or immediately alongside exposed water to prevent the unit falling into it CONNECTION TO ELECTRICAL SUPPLY If in doubt consult a qualified electrician CAUTION Installation must comply with the relevant local wiring guidelines and legislation Please consult a qualified electrician

11. d to be monitored periodically throughout the day IMPORTANT The SYSTEM 2500 5000 like any other biological filtration units require a maturation period to allow colonisation of the appropriate levels of nitrifying bacteria before it can be used on a fully stocked system 16 The length of the maturation period will vary from 4 12 weeks depending on the initial stocking levels water temperatures feed rates and other criteria Throughout this period ammonia and nitrite should be monitored daily to assess the progress of the maturation process Further stocking should only be VERSION 22 03 2013 PAGE 9 TMC COMMERCIAL 17 18 considered once the system is fully matured When reservoir levels are low due to maintenance or high sales ensure the pumps are not allowed to draw air It is strongly recommended that systems be fitted with water level switches to ensure that water pumps cannot draw air Do not allow bubbles from return water to be drawn into the pump inlet CAUTION All of these will cause embolism that will kill livestock All items supplied with this system are covered by warranties under Tropical Marine Centre s standard terms and conditions However Tropical Marine Centre Limited cannot be held responsible for any subsequent damage or the loss of livestock caused by the failure of any system component VERSION 22 03 2013 SYSTEM 2500 5000 FRESHWATER USER GUIDE PAGE 10 TMC COMMER

17. z sleeve Unscrew the compression fitting at either end of the lamp assembly Remove the o ring at either end of the quartz sleeve assembly NOTE If water pours out of the unit at this stage then the unit has either not been isolated from the system or not drained prior to commencing the maintenance procedure Remove the o rings and discard them O rings should be replaced at each service interval After removing the o ring carefully slide out the quartz sleeve Clean the quartz sleeve by washing in warm soapy water Rinse it thoroughly in fresh water then dry and polish it using a paper towel NOTE If the quartz sleeve has calcified with lime scale deposits from the water it should be cleaned with a proprietary plastic kettle descaling solution following the manufacturer s recommendations Plastic gloves and eye protection should be worn for this process The quartz sleeve should be rinsed in fresh water dried and polished with a paper towel To reassemble the unit reverse the above procedure by carefully sliding the quartz sleeves back into the plastic housing and locating it correctly Slide new o rings over either end of the quartz sleeve and locate them into the o ring recess on the main casing Ensure the female threads on the compression fitting and the male threads on the main plastic body are clean Wipe a little silicon grease or Vaseline NOT silicon sealant onto these threads As these threads
